From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Ihor Radchenko Newsgroups: gmane.emacs.bugs Subject: bug#55672: 29.0.50; Emacs crashes when calling start-process-shell-command xdg-open with process-connection-type set to nil Date: Fri, 27 May 2022 18:13:22 +0800 Message-ID: References: <87a6b3wkzs.fsf@localhost> <87ilprihg0.fsf@yahoo.com> <87h75bh0zs.fsf@localhost> <877d67ieri.fsf@yahoo.com> <87k0a7l5yt.fsf@localhost> <87o7zjgxio.fsf@yahoo.com> <874k1b2v6r.fsf@localhost> <87k0a7gw3w.fsf@yahoo.com> <87ilprs3vl.fsf@localhost> <87bkvjguwu.fsf@yahoo.com> <875ylrgue6.fsf@yahoo.com> Mime-Version: 1.0 Content-Type: multipart/alternative; boundary="0000000000008761df05dffb8c41"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="13606"; mail-complaints-to="usenet@ciao.gmane.io" Cc: 55672@debbugs.gnu.org To: Po Lu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Fri May 27 12:13:32 2022 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1nuWyK-0003MG-4h for geb-bug-gnu-emacs@m.gmane-mx.org; Fri, 27 May 2022 12:13:32 +0200 Original-Received: from localhost ([::1]:57546 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1nuWyI-0001RY-IF for geb-bug-gnu-emacs@m.gmane-mx.org; Fri, 27 May 2022 06:13:30 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:53254)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1nuWxr-0001Qo-K4 for bug-gnu-emacs@gnu.org; Fri, 27 May 2022 06:13:05 -0400 Original-Received: from debbugs.gnu.org ([209.51.188.43]:38889)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1nuWxq-0002YD-ND for bug-gnu-emacs@gnu.org; Fri, 27 May 2022 06:13:03 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1nuWxq-0005Nr-Ff for bug-gnu-emacs@gnu.org; Fri, 27 May 2022 06:13:02 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Ihor Radchenko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Fri, 27 May 2022 10:13: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 55672 X-GNU-PR-Package: emacs Original-Received: via spool by 55672-submit@debbugs.gnu.org id=B55672.165364637920685 (code B ref 55672); Fri, 27 May 2022 10:13:02 +0000 Original-Received: (at 55672) by debbugs.gnu.org; 27 May 2022 10:12:59 +0000 Original-Received: from localhost ([127.0.0.1]:32786 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1nuWxm-0005NZ-FT for submit@debbugs.gnu.org; Fri, 27 May 2022 06:12:58 -0400 Original-Received: from mail-lf1-f43.google.com ([209.85.167.43]:46697)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1nuWxl-0005NM-1b for 55672@debbugs.gnu.org; Fri, 27 May 2022 06:12:57 -0400 Original-Received: by mail-lf1-f43.google.com with SMTP id w14so6098771lfl.13 for <55672@debbugs.gnu.org>; Fri, 27 May 2022 03:12:57 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=jPGWGWtShNdx7WOgs2N4pFsvkgcqvMHD+osj0S0bITU=; b=W5a0DnAw2HcWP6L8jYXMdNPc9U4LLsHX2Tei+JDqj6QHEM+SxAr2h/ckuJHlCMgw30 +mjyRxJ0W9hSF1QXYRO6AY2LfRRoT2eGGQjLIk+CsTvfNj6SwiE5hXHPvL6crUu24Cvn hjUAa6wbop6cfvSjRecTlGzKGkPFve+9KUms9zhIaQzSS7NGIMBSP3NxBR5FFk4gCUY8 xbQ7et34J+syyhPNsWGjehvKr7GgKGy+YhJmQUyU4EAiazB5pklum8NI1xwweVRHaCGL w3w9XMtXUW865n+uAuCY23uc+aSmS6ERVwU0d4884g1oLiKQYWq1ZnT+2c0lTwJSOang A7Bg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=jPGWGWtShNdx7WOgs2N4pFsvkgcqvMHD+osj0S0bITU=; b=2tf3QYBCFfbDFhBQja2h6Wb40PZH+kO28FI7BTPazx0WQPgQc0MBc1hRYRxJU35LLg OpXqB2208IX2UW2paMcoaFkgnFqmCRoO/VqGB9uZDS/G/sVR2DDvye3oMS/veJHyw4vq U5YntlvHlp7hRZo49CwRZTj8G5rFqJfeRP/UlA6brh7Yk+5cGWu+YMZzPlTMkoh9Tsw5 kaIbQmEWP0YWUrWMIehuxgNFqZEqyc28iZmYgVSFwDSkaEUGwFfiCCGfdb9pFIyBNcOH yqwA0nUTJz70kemujQugqWYmRywYk4bCY3hEvhQ2R9PP/h+V84CN/JUekm91P8O10gy4 N7RQ== X-Gm-Message-State: AOAM533coGXbf4hXb3iwiTpnG9vyYriIsvdbwoE88xMrj3ib0W/7uwZk 5oTK4Fvws9zivLTq0YOuA+OKVYXY5vFDCCdLsns= X-Google-Smtp-Source: ABdhPJzHh66nswy6HywA8ukl6ab3yKIFT8fK1pjUuKKhxc9o/Qnt0jxdko+RQd/KSV02pEORiopuICiukUlfZl8bU6s= X-Received: by 2002:a05:6512:159d:b0:478:94fa:5f7e with SMTP id bp29-20020a056512159d00b0047894fa5f7emr10902481lfb.379.1653646371020; Fri, 27 May 2022 03:12:51 -0700 (PDT) In-Reply-To: <875ylrgue6.fsf@yahoo.com> X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.io gmane.emacs.bugs:233172 Archived-At: --0000000000008761df05dffb8c41 Content-Type: text/plain; charset="UTF-8" (gdb) up 6 #6 0x00007ffff6c7dcfe in cairo_xcb_surface_create () from /usr/lib64/libcairo.so.2 (gdb) up #7 0x00005555556fb83b in x_begin_cr_clip (f=0x555556c49ce0, gc=0x0) at xterm.c:4681 4681 surface = cairo_xcb_surface_create (FRAME_DISPLAY_INFO (f)->xcb_connection, (gdb) p *f->output_data.x $1 = { toolbar_top_height = 0, toolbar_bottom_height = 0, toolbar_left_width = 0, toolbar_right_width = 0, border_tile = 6291486, normal_gc = 0x55555703f7e0, reverse_gc = 0x55555979fc40, cursor_gc = 0x5555589f9450, window_desc = 6291481, draw_desc = 6291482, picture = 0, need_buffer_flip = true, icon_desc = 0, parent_desc = 14713974, user_time_window = 6291481, icon_bitmap = 1, font = 0x5555561057b0, baseline_offset = 0, fontset = 2, cursor_pixel = 4278190080, border_pixel = 4278190080, mouse_pixel = 4278190080, cursor_foreground_pixel = 4294967295, scroll_bar_foreground_pixel = 18446744073709551615, scroll_bar_background_pixel = 18446744073709551615, text_cursor = 6291466, nontext_cursor = 6291467, modeline_cursor = 6291469, hand_cursor = 6291470, hourglass_cursor = 6291468, horizontal_drag_cursor = 6291471, vertical_drag_cursor = 6291472, current_cursor = 6291466, left_edge_cursor = 6291473, top_left_corner_cursor = 6291474, top_edge_cursor = 6291475, top_right_corner_cursor = 6291476, right_edge_cursor = 6291477, bottom_right_corner_cursor = 6291478, bottom_edge_cursor = 6291479, bottom_left_corner_cursor = 6291480, hourglass_window = 0, wm_hints = { flags = 39, input = 1, initial_state = 1, icon_pixmap = 6291488, icon_window = 0, --Type for more, q to quit, c to continue without paging--c icon_x = 0, icon_y = 0, icon_mask = 6291490, window_group = 0 }, display_info = 0x5555562d7980, saved_menu_event = 0x0, hourglass_p = false, explicit_parent = false, asked_for_visible = true, has_been_visible = true, wait_for_wm = true, alpha_identical_p = true, xic = 0x55555c4c79f0, xic_style = 1032, xic_xfs = 0x0, basic_frame_counter = 6291492, extended_frame_counter = 0, pending_basic_counter_value = { hi = 0, lo = 0 }, current_extended_counter_value = { hi = 0, lo = 0 }, sync_end_pending_p = false, ext_sync_end_pending_p = false, black_relief = { gc = 0x0, pixel = 18446744073709551615 }, white_relief = { gc = 0x0, pixel = 18446744073709551615 }, relief_background = 0, focus_state = 0, move_offset_top = 0, move_offset_left = 0, cr_context = 0x0, cr_surface_desired_width = 674, cr_surface_desired_height = 593, preedit_size = 0, preedit_chars = 0x0, preedit_active = false, preedit_caret = 0, xi_masks = 0x555556bafc90, num_xi_masks = 2 } (gdb) --0000000000008761df05dffb8c41 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able
(gdb) up 6
#6 0x00007ffff6c7dcfe in = cairo_xcb_surface_create () from /usr/lib64/libcairo.so.2
(gdb) u= p
#7 0x00005555556fb83b in x_begin_cr_clip (f=3D0x555556c49ce0, = gc=3D0x0) at xterm.c:4681
4681 surface =3D cairo_xcb_surface_cre= ate (FRAME_DISPLAY_INFO (f)->xcb_connection,
(gdb) p *f->ou= tput_data.x
$1 =3D {
=C2=A0 toolbar_top_height =3D 0,
=C2=A0 toolbar_bottom_height =3D 0,
=C2=A0 toolbar_left_= width =3D 0,
=C2=A0 toolbar_right_width =3D 0,
=C2=A0 b= order_tile =3D 6291486,
=C2=A0 normal_gc =3D 0x55555703f7e0,
=C2=A0 reverse_gc =3D 0x55555979fc40,
=C2=A0 cursor_gc =3D = 0x5555589f9450,
=C2=A0 window_desc =3D 6291481,
=C2=A0 = draw_desc =3D 6291482,
=C2=A0 picture =3D 0,
=C2=A0 nee= d_buffer_flip =3D true,
=C2=A0 icon_desc =3D 0,
=C2=A0 = parent_desc =3D 14713974,
=C2=A0 user_time_window =3D 6291481,
=C2=A0 icon_bitmap =3D 1,
=C2=A0 font =3D 0x5555561057b0,=
=C2=A0 baseline_offset =3D 0,
=C2=A0 fontset =3D 2,
=C2=A0 cursor_pixel =3D 4278190080,
=C2=A0 border_pixel = =3D 4278190080,
=C2=A0 mouse_pixel =3D 4278190080,
=C2= =A0 cursor_foreground_pixel =3D 4294967295,
=C2=A0 scroll_bar_for= eground_pixel =3D 18446744073709551615,
=C2=A0 scroll_bar_backgro= und_pixel =3D 18446744073709551615,
=C2=A0 text_cursor =3D 629146= 6,
=C2=A0 nontext_cursor =3D 6291467,
=C2=A0 modeline_c= ursor =3D 6291469,
=C2=A0 hand_cursor =3D 6291470,
=C2= =A0 hourglass_cursor =3D 6291468,
=C2=A0 horizontal_drag_cursor = =3D 6291471,
=C2=A0 vertical_drag_cursor =3D 6291472,
= =C2=A0 current_cursor =3D 6291466,
=C2=A0 left_edge_cursor =3D 62= 91473,
=C2=A0 top_left_corner_cursor =3D 6291474,
=C2= =A0 top_edge_cursor =3D 6291475,
=C2=A0 top_right_corner_cursor = =3D 6291476,
=C2=A0 right_edge_cursor =3D 6291477,
=C2= =A0 bottom_right_corner_cursor =3D 6291478,
=C2=A0 bottom_edge_cu= rsor =3D 6291479,
=C2=A0 bottom_left_corner_cursor =3D 6291480,
=C2=A0 hourglass_window =3D 0,
=C2=A0 wm_hints =3D {
=C2=A0 =C2=A0 flags =3D 39,
=C2=A0 =C2=A0 input =3D 1,
=C2=A0 =C2=A0 initial_state =3D 1,
=C2=A0 =C2=A0 icon_pixm= ap =3D 6291488,
=C2=A0 =C2=A0 icon_window =3D 0,
--Type= <RET> for more, q to quit, c to continue without paging--c
=C2=A0 =C2=A0 icon_x =3D 0,
=C2=A0 =C2=A0 icon_y =3D 0,
=C2=A0 =C2=A0 icon_mask =3D 6291490,
=C2=A0 =C2=A0 window_group= =3D 0
=C2=A0 },
=C2=A0 display_info =3D 0x5555562d7980= ,
=C2=A0 saved_menu_event =3D 0x0,
=C2=A0 hourglass_p = =3D false,
=C2=A0 explicit_parent =3D false,
=C2=A0 ask= ed_for_visible =3D true,
=C2=A0 has_been_visible =3D true,
<= div>=C2=A0 wait_for_wm =3D true,
=C2=A0 alpha_identical_p =3D tru= e,
=C2=A0 xic =3D 0x55555c4c79f0,
=C2=A0 xic_style =3D = 1032,
=C2=A0 xic_xfs =3D 0x0,
=C2=A0 basic_frame_counte= r =3D 6291492,
=C2=A0 extended_frame_counter =3D 0,
=C2= =A0 pending_basic_counter_value =3D {
=C2=A0 =C2=A0 hi =3D 0,
=C2=A0 =C2=A0 lo =3D 0
=C2=A0 },
=C2=A0 current_= extended_counter_value =3D {
=C2=A0 =C2=A0 hi =3D 0,
= =C2=A0 =C2=A0 lo =3D 0
=C2=A0 },
=C2=A0 sync_end_pendin= g_p =3D false,
=C2=A0 ext_sync_end_pending_p =3D false,
=C2=A0 black_relief =3D {
=C2=A0 =C2=A0 gc =3D 0x0,
= =C2=A0 =C2=A0 pixel =3D 18446744073709551615
=C2=A0 },
= =C2=A0 white_relief =3D {
=C2=A0 =C2=A0 gc =3D 0x0,
=C2= =A0 =C2=A0 pixel =3D 18446744073709551615
=C2=A0 },
=C2= =A0 relief_background =3D 0,
=C2=A0 focus_state =3D 0,
= =C2=A0 move_offset_top =3D 0,
=C2=A0 move_offset_left =3D 0,
=C2=A0 cr_context =3D 0x0,
=C2=A0 cr_surface_desired_width = =3D 674,
=C2=A0 cr_surface_desired_height =3D 593,
=C2= =A0 preedit_size =3D 0,
=C2=A0 preedit_chars =3D 0x0,
= =C2=A0 preedit_active =3D false,
=C2=A0 preedit_caret =3D 0,
=C2=A0 xi_masks =3D 0x555556bafc90,
=C2=A0 num_xi_masks =3D= 2
}
(gdb)=C2=A0
--0000000000008761df05dffb8c41--